BREAKING! Super Eagles’ Goalkeeper Carl Ikeme beats cancer

Wolverhampton Wanderers and Super Eagles first choice Goalkeeper, Carl Ikeme has beaten Cancer after revealing that his cancer is in “complete remission.”

 

Ikeme shared the news via his Twitter handle, tweeting; “After a year of intense chemotherapy I would like to share that I am in complete REMISSION.”

 

The 32-year-old Goalkeeper has been battling acute leukaemia which made him sit out of the Super Eagles World Cup and Wolves squad.

 

Ahead of the Group D game on Friday, Iceland players sent their best wishes to Ikeme, with Ikeme’s name imprinted on the number 1 jersey of Iceland.

 

The Super Eagles won the game, 2:0, thanks to pacy forward Ahmed Musa, who scored both goals.
